Título : | On the use of biased randomization and simheuristics to solve Vehicle and Arc Routing Problems |
Autoría: | González Martín, Sergio Barrios Barrios, Barry Juan, Angel A. ![]() Riera Terrén, Daniel ![]() |
Citación : | Gonzalez, S., Barrios, B., Juan, A. & Riera, D. (2014). On the Use of Biased Randomization and Simheuristics to Solve Vehicle and Arc Routing Problems. Winter Simulation Conference (WSC). Proceedings, 2014 (). 1875-1884. doi: 10.1109/WSC.2014.7020035 |
Resumen : | This paper reviews the main concepts and existing literature related to the use of biased randomization of classical heuristics and the combination of simulation with meta-heuristics (Simheuristics) in order to solve complex combinatorial optimization problems, both of deterministic and stochastic nature, in the popular field of Vehicle and Arc Routing Problems. The paper performs a holistic approach to these concepts, synthesizes several cases of successful application from the existing literature, and proposes a general simulation-based framework for solving richer variants of Vehicle and Arc Routing Problems. Also examples of algorithms based on this framework successfully applied to concrete cases of Vehicle and Arc Routing Problems are presented. |
